#f55b98 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f55b98 is composed of 96.1% red, 35.7%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.9% magenta, 38%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 336.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 65.9%. #f55b98 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b6ff with #eb0031.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#f55b98 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f55b98 has RGB values of R:245, G:91,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.38,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16079768.

Hex triplet f55b98 #f55b98
RGB Decimal 245, 91, 152 rgb(245,91,152)
RGB Percent 96.1, 35.7, 59.6 rgb(96.1%,35.7%,59.6%)
CMYK 0, 63, 38, 4
HSL 336.2°, 88.5, 65.9 hsl(336.2,88.5%,65.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 336.2°, 62.9, 96.1
Web Safe ff6699 #ff6699
CIE-LAB 60.928, 63.987, -1.512
XYZ 47.066, 29.166, 32.855
xyY 0.431, 0.267, 29.166
CIE-LCH 60.928, 64.004, 358.646
CIE-LUV 60.928, 99.019, -14.402
Hunter-Lab 54.005, 61.053, 1.734
Binary 11110101, 01011011, 10011000

Shades and Tints of #f55b98

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#feeff5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f55b98

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aba5a7 is the less saturated color, while #fc5497 is the most saturated one.
